Ginger secures $50M to expand mental health platform solutions

Aug. 7, 2020
By Meg Bryant
On-demand mental health company Ginger.io scooped up $50 million in a series D round that was led by Advance Venture Partners and Bessemer Venture Partners. Participants also included Cigna Ventures and existing investors such as Jeff Weiner, executive chairman of Linkedin, and Kaiser Permanente Venture.

Teladoc, Livongo to merge after striking $18.5B deal

Aug. 5, 2020
By Liz Hollis
Following Siemens Healthineers AG’s announcement that it was picking up Varian Medical Systems Inc. for $16.4 billion, another multibillion-dollar deal has emerged. This time, Teladoc Health Inc. and Livongo Health Inc. have inked a definitive merger agreement with a value of $18.5 billion. The transaction is expected to close by the end of the fourth quarter, subject to shareholder approvals and other customary closing conditions.

White House moves on telehealth executive order to counter rural hospital closure

Aug. 4, 2020
By Mark McCarty
The Trump administration has issued an executive order designed to improve access to telehealth for Medicare beneficiaries in rural America, making permanent numerous changes that had been temporarily added for the COVID-19 pandemic. The news arrives as the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) posted the draft Medicare physician fee schedule (MPFS) complete with expanded use of telehealth for a number of services.

CBO scoring a significant hurdle in proposals to permanently expand telehealth coverage

July 23, 2020
By Mark McCarty
The support for permanent changes to Medicare coverage of telehealth has risen drastically in the months since the COVID-19 pandemic began, but Krista Drobac of Sirona Strategies said on a July 23 webinar that stakeholders will have to help make the case that telehealth is cost effective. That cost effectiveness argument may be absolutely crucial if any of the related legislative proposals are to stand up to budget scoring in a time of skyrocketing U.S. budget deficits, she said.

Digital health funding hits new high with $6.3B in H1 2020

July 17, 2020
By Meg Bryant
Digital health bucked uncertainties around the COVID-19 pandemic, reeling in $6.3 billion in funding in the first half of 2020, according to a new report from Mercom Capital Group. The record-setting, global haul was 24% higher than last year’s first-half raise of $5.1 billion.

Novasight raises $8M to back vision care solutions

July 14, 2020
By Meg Bryant
Novasight Ltd. has scooped up $8 million in a series A financing that’s intended to get the company through a pivotal study of its first U.S. indication, Curesight, as well as to advance other pipeline products. The Israeli startup is tackling a range of pediatric vision disorders using artificial intelligence and eye-tracking technology.

Support for telehealth growing, but privacy still a sticking point

July 13, 2020
By Mark McCarty
If there’s a readily visible upside to the COVID-19 pandemic, it may be that telehealth is not only much more accessible, it’s also supremely topical among policymakers. However, privacy concerns are still a significant source of drag in some respects, a consideration that extends to digital medicine as well in the context of contact tracing used to corral the SARS-CoV-2 virus.

Doctor On Demand raises $75M in series D

July 8, 2020
By Meg Bryant
Virtual care provider Doctor On Demand has scooped up $75 million in a series D round led by General Atlantic, with participation from existing investors. The funds are earmarked to fuel the company’s growth and expand access to comprehensive telehealth services across the U.S. Combined with earlier financings, the San Francisco-based company has raised nearly $240 million to date.

Clinicians wary of AI’s insertion into practice despite potential use in telehealth

June 26, 2020
By Mark McCarty
Conventional wisdom has it that recent expansions in coverage of telehealth will never be fully reversed. The addition of artificial intelligence (AI) into telehealth could solve several issues faced by doctors and hospitals. There is some concern, however, that the blending of AI and telehealth will industrialize the practice of medicine, dissuading patients from seeking critically needed care.

Witnesses at Senate hearing press for annual appropriation for vaccine infrastructure

June 23, 2020
By Mark McCarty
The Senate Health, Education, Labor and Pensions (HELP) Committee met again June 23 to discuss the federal government response to the COVID-19 pandemic, and one clear signal that emerged from the hearing is that Congress will have to provide annual funding to build a sustainable infrastructure for vaccine development and manufacture if the nation is to deal appropriately with the next pandemic.
